Partial isothermal sections of the Al-Pd-Ru phase diagram at 1000, 1050 and 1100 degrees C are presented here. The Al-Pd orthorhombic epsilon-phases dissolve up to similar to 15.5 at.% Ru, Al13Ru4 < 2.5 at.% Pd and Al2Ru up to 1 at.% Pd. Between 66 and 75 at.% Al, ternary quasiperiodic icosahedral phase and three cubic phases: C (Pm (3) over bar, a = 0.7757 nm) C-1 (lm (3) over bar, a = 1.5532 nm) and C-2 (Fm (3) over bar, a = 1.5566 nm) were revealed. An additional complex cubic structure with a approximate to 3.96 nm was found to be formed at compositions close to those of the icosahedral phase. (C) 2007 Elsevier B.V. All rights reserved. |
